Josef Rheinberger's "Organ Sonatas, Vol. 5" is a captivating collection of three of his most renowned organ sonatas, recorded and released on July 15, 2017, under the Raven label. This album offers a rich and diverse listening experience, spanning a total of 75 minutes. Rheinberger, a German composer known for his profound contributions to sacred music, showcases his mastery of the organ in this volume.
The album opens with the powerful and introspective Organ Sonata No. 9 in B Minor, Op. 142, featuring four distinct movements that range from the contemplative Präludium to the dynamic Finale (Fuga). Following this, the Organ Sonata No. 13 in E-Flat Major, Op. 161, presents a more lyrical and expressive side of Rheinberger's compositional style, with its Phantasie, Canzone, Intermezzo, and Fuge movements. The album concludes with the Organ Sonata No. 7 in F Minor, Op. 127, which includes a Preludio, Andante, and a compelling Finale featuring a Grave - Fuga.
